What is Plumbing Rope Access?

Plumbing rope access involves utilizing industrial ropes, specialized equipment, and highly skilled technicians to access plumbing installations at heights or in confined spaces. The technique borrows its principles from industrial rope access but focuses specifically on plumbing-related tasks, such as inspections, maintenance, repairs, and installations.

Advantages of Plumbing Rope Access

  1. Enhanced Safety: Safety is a paramount concern in any plumbing task, especially when working at heights or in challenging locations. Rope access provides a secure and controlled means for plumbers to reach the required areas, minimizing the risk of accidents and injuries associated with traditional access methods, such as scaffolding or cranes.

  2. Time and Cost Efficiency: Plumbing rope access eliminates the need for complex and time-consuming setups associated with scaffolding or boom lifts. Technicians can quickly ascend or descend to the necessary locations, reducing downtime and saving costs on equipment and labor.

  3. Minimized Disruption: Plumbing repairs in busy urban areas or occupied buildings can cause significant disruption to residents or businesses. Rope access allows plumbers to access plumbing systems externally, minimizing disturbance to occupants and reducing the need for interior access.

  4. Versatility: Whether it’s inspecting drainage systems, repairing pipes, or installing fixtures, plumbing rope access can be employed in various scenarios. The versatility of the technique makes it suitable for different types of plumbing tasks in diverse environments.

  5. Preservation of Building Facades: Traditional access methods often require installing scaffolding that can obstruct the building’s exterior and cause damage to its façade. Plumbing rope access avoids this issue, as it relies on temporary anchor points that leave minimal trace upon removal.

  6. Environmentally Friendly: Plumbing rope access requires minimal equipment, which translates to reduced carbon footprint and less environmental impact compared to heavy machinery used in traditional access methods.

Challenges and Safety Measures

While plumbing rope access offers numerous advantages, it’s essential to address potential challenges and prioritize safety. Technicians must undergo rigorous training and certification to ensure they have the necessary skills and knowledge for working at heights. Regular safety inspections, equipment checks, and adherence to industry best practices are critical to maintaining a safe working environment.
